در این دوره به یادگیری موتور بازیسازی یونیتی پرداخته میشود. این دوره به این صورت برنامهریزی شده است که از مقدمات شروع شده و به مباحث پیشرفته تر می پردازد. هدف از برگزاری دوره آموزش ... ادامه
آشنایی با یونیتی
یادگیری سی شارپ در یونیتی
اصول پایه برنامه نویسی در بازیسازی
درک بازیسازی
این دوره به نحوی تهیه و تدوین شده است که مباحث آن به سادهترین شکل ممکن بیان شوند و مخاطبان دوره بتوانند بهسادگی متوجه موضوعات مطرح شده شوند. به همین جهت برای شرکت در این دوره هیچ پیشنیاز به خصوصی وجود ندارد و افراد با هر سطحی از آگاهی و تحصیلات میتوانند از مباحث این دوره نهایت استفاده را داشته باشند.
در این دوره به یادگیری موتور بازیسازی یونیتی پرداخته میشود. این دوره به این صورت برنامهریزی شده است که از مقدمات شروع شده و به مباحث پیشرفته تر می پردازد.
هدف از برگزاری این دوره، آشنایی با یونیتی و برنامه نویسی سی شارپ به صورت مرحله به مرحله از مباحث مقدماتی تا مباحث پیشرفته است. شرکت در این دوره آموزشی به شما کمک خواهد کرد تا درک خود را از برنامه نویسی سی شارپ در یونیتی ارتقا دهید. در کنار این موضوع موتوجه خواهید شد که ساخت بازی با یونیتی از نظر زمان و هزینه چقدر کمتر از سایر موتورهای بازیسازی خواهد بود.
هرکسی که به ساخت بازی علاقهمند است میتواند در دوره شرکت کند. این دوره آموزشی به نحوی تدوین شده که تمام کسانی که در دوره شرکت میکنند به راحتی بتوانند دوره را به اتمام برسانند.
این دوره هیچ گونه پیشنیازی ندارد تنها کافیست بلد باشید که چگونه کامیوتر را خاموش و روشن کنید.
آیا تا به حال آرزو کردهاید که بازی کامپیوتری یا موبایلی مدنظر خود را بسازید؟ دنیایی را تصور کنید که در آن قوانین را شما وضع میکنید، شخصیتها جان میگیرند و ماجراجوییهای هیجانانگیز رقم میخورند. موتور بازیسازی یونیتی (Unity) این قدرت را به شما میدهد تا رؤیاهای بازیسازیتان را به واقعیت تبدیل کنید. در آموزش جامع یونیتی شما قدمبهقدم با نحوه ساخت بازی با این موتور بازیسازی محبوب آشنا خواهید شد.
یونیتی یک موتور بازیسازی چند سکویی است که به شما امکان میدهد بازیهای دوبعدی، سهبعدی، واقعیت مجازی (VR) و واقعیت افزوده (AR) را برای رایانههای شخصی، کنسولها، تلفنهای همراه و وب ایجاد کنید. محبوبیت یونیتی به دلیل رابط کاربری کاربرپسند، انعطافپذیری بالا و جامعه پر رونق آن است. با یادگیری این موتور بازیسازی با استفاده از دوره آموزش جامع Unity، نهتنها مهارتهای ارزشمندی برای ساخت بازی به دست میآورید، بلکه دروازهای به دنیای سرگرمی دیجیتال، آموزش و شبیهسازی به روی شما باز میشود.
خبر خوب این است که برای شروع کار با یونیتی نیازی به تجربه برنامهنویسی حرفهای ندارید. با داشتن دانش پایهای از ریاضیات و علاقه به بازیهای ویدیویی، میتوانید به راحتی وارد این مسیر شوید. البته یادگیری زبان برنامهنویسی C# به طور قابل توجهی به درک عمیق تر از یونیتی و کنترل بیشتری بر جنبههای فنی بازیسازی کمک میکند.
اولین قدم برای ورود به دنیای یونیتی، نصب نرمافزار آن است. به وبسایت رسمی یونیتی (https://unity.com/) مراجعه کنید و آخرین نسخه یونیتی را متناسب با سیستمعامل خود دانلود کنید. پس از دانلود، مراحل نصب را دنبال کنید و در نهایت نرمافزار یونیتی را اجرا کنید.
با باز کردن یونیتی، با رابط کاربری نسبتاً پیچیدهای مواجه میشوید. نگران نباشید! بهتدریج با اجزای مختلف آن آشنا خواهید شد. به طور کلی، رابط کاربری یونیتی از بخشهای زیر تشکیل شده است:
با گذشت زمان و تمرین، کار با این بخشها برای شما به امری عادی تبدیل خواهد شد.
برای اینکه دستبهکار شوید، بیایید اولین پروژه یونیتی خود را ایجاد کنیم. در منوی بالای یونیتی، گزینه File و سپس New Project را انتخاب کنید. به پروژه خود نام دلخواه بدهید و محل ذخیرهسازی آن را مشخص کنید. پس از کلیک بر روی Create Project، یونیتی پروژه جدید شما را راهاندازی خواهد کرد.
هر چیزی که در بازی شما وجود دارد، از شخصیتها و محیطها گرفته تا صداها و افکتها، به عنوان یک شیء (Object) در یونیتی شناخته میشود که در دوره آموزش جامع یونیتی به این موضوع پرداخته شده است. اشیاء دارای ویژگیها و رفتارهای خاصی هستند که توسط کامپوننتها (Components) تعریف میشوند. کامپوننتها بلوکهای سازنده بازی شما هستند و عملکردهای مختلفی را بر عهده دارند، مانند کنترل حرکت اشیاء، نمایش گرافیک، پخش صدا و غیره.
ایجاد اشیاء در یونیتی بسیار ساده است. به تب Hierarchy مراجعه کنید و بر روی دکمه Create کلیک کنید. فهرستی از انواع اشیاء مختلف مانند مکعب، کره، دوربین و نور را مشاهده خواهید کرد. شیء مورد نظر خود را انتخاب کنید تا درصحنه بازی شما ظاهر شود. در دوره آموزش جامع Unity این موضوع کاملاً به صورت تخصصی بررسی شده است.
با انتخاب یک شیء در سلسله مراتب، میتوانید کامپوننتهای مختلف را به آن اضافه کنید. در تب Inspector، فهرستی از کامپوننتهای موجود را مشاهده میکنید. هر کامپوننت دارای تنظیمات خاص خود است که میتوانید آنها را در تب Inspector ویرایش کنید.
همانطور که اشاره شد، یونیتی از زبان برنامهنویسی C# برای اسکریپت نویسی و اعمال منطق بازی استفاده میکند. اگرچه تسلط بر C# برای ساخت بازیهای ساده ضروری نیست، اما یادگیری آن به شما امکان میدهد تا کنترل بیشتری بر بازی خود داشته باشید و قابلیتهای پیچیدهتری را به آن اضافه کنید.
خوشبختانه، منابع آموزشی بسیار زیادی برای یادگیری یونیتی به زبان فارسی در دسترس است. وبسایت رسمی یونیتی، مستندات جامعی را به همراه آموزشهای ویدیویی ارائه میدهد. همچنین، کانالهای یوتیوب فارسی زبان متعددی وجود دارند که به طور اختصاصی به آموزش یونیتی میپردازند. مکتب خونه نیز انواع دوره آموزش یونیتی را برگزار کرده است که دوره حاضر یعنی دوره آموزش Unity جامع از بهترین این دورهها است.
در ساخت بازی با یونیتی حتماً به نکات زیر دقت کنید:
همانطور که گفته شد، برای ساخت بازیهای ساده در یونیتی نیازی به دانش برنامهنویسی حرفهای ندارید. با این حال، یادگیری زبان برنامهنویسی C# به شما امکان میدهد تا کنترل بیشتری بر بازی خود داشته باشید و قابلیتهای پیچیدهتری را به آن اضافه کنید.
منابع زیر برای یادگیری یونیتی بسیار اهمیت دارند:
یونیتی برای ساخت انواع مختلف بازیها از جمله بازیهای دوبعدی، سهبعدی، واقعیت مجازی (VR) و واقعیت افزوده (AR) مناسب است.
بله یونیتی رابط کاربری نسبتاً کاربرپسندی دارد و برای افراد مبتدی که هیچ تجربه برنامهنویسی قبلی ندارند نیز مناسب است.
دوره جامع آموزش یونیتی فرصتی استثنایی برای علاقهمندان به ساخت بازیهای ویدیویی و تجربیات تعاملی که میخواهند مهارتهای خود را در این زمینه ارتقا دهند. این دوره آموزش جامع unity با ارائهی آموزشهای جامع و کاربردی در تمامی سطوح، از مبتدی تا پیشرفته، شما را به طور کامل برای ورود به دنیای یونیتی و خلق بازیهای منحصربهفرد خود آماده میکند.
سرفصلهای دوره آموزش جامع unity به صورت زیر هستند:
دوره نام برده برای افراد زیر مناسب است:
با گذراندن دوره آموزش جامع یونیتی مفاهیم زیر را یاد خواهید گرفت:
این دوره با ارائهی آموزشهای جامع یونیتی، کاربردی و به زبان فارسی به شما کمک میکند تا در مدت زمان کوتاهی مهارتهای لازم برای ساخت بازیهای خود را به دست آورید و به جمع حرفهایهای یونیتی بپیوندید.
یونیتی ابزاری قدرتمند و انعطافپذیر برای ساخت بازیهای ویدیویی و تجربیات تعاملی است. با یادگیری یونیتی، میتوانید دنیای خلاقانه خود را به واقعیت تبدیل کنید و بازیهایی را بسازید که دیگران از آن لذت ببرند. در مکتب خونه انواع دوره آموزش برنامه نویسی، آموزش بازی سازی و آموزش سی شارپ به عنوان مکمل و پیشنیاز این دوره موجود است.
اطلاعات بیشتر
از مجموع 4 امتیاز
2 نظرپس از گذراندن محتوای دوره به صورت آنلاین (بدون دانلود) در سایت مکتبخونه، در صورتی که حد نصاب قبولی در دوره را کسب و تمرین ها و پروژه های الزامی را ارسال کنید، گواهینامه رسمی پایان دوره توسط مکتبخونه به اسم شما صادر شده و در اختیار شما قرار میگیرد.
قابل اشتراکگذاری در
ایوب کمرهئی از سال 1390 در زمینهی طراحی و ساخت بازیهای ویدئویی فعالیت دارد. ایشان در طول فعالیتش با تیمهای بازیسازی مستقل تجربهی کاری داشته است. وی سابقه تدریس بازیسازی با موتورهای متفاوت بازیسازی مانند دوره آموزش UDK، دوره آموزش UNREAL ENGINE و دوره آموزش Unity داشته است.
آدرس وب سایت: kmb.academy (کی ام بی اکادمی)
اطلاعات بیشتر